We’re back with another packed episode diving into the JConcepts INS15 Series! Join Lefty and Jason Ruona as they break down all the action from Round 3 at Island Speedway and preview what’s to come at Round 4 at the legendary Hobbyplex in Omaha.

🏁 We cover standout performances from Nate Sontag, Dustin Fox, Talon Henley, and more as the series heads into its tightest stretch yet. 🛞 Get insight into how layout design and driver consistency played a key role at Island. 📊 Series points updates, who's in contention, and who needs to step it up heading into RD4. 📍 Plus, we look ahead to Hobbyplex’s unique elevated layout, strong local racing scene, and the hotly anticipated new platform debuts from Associated and Schumacher.

Also discussed: – Xray’s quest for a full-season sweep – The current state of national 10th scale racing in the U.S. – Upcoming events including the Carpet Worlds at Beachline RC – And a look into JConcepts' expanding presence in the crawler scene

The heart was always off-limits to surgeons. Cutting into it spelled instant death for the patient. That is, until a ragtag group of doctors scattered across the Midwest and Texas decided to throw out the rule book. Working in makeshift laboratories and home garages, using medical devices made from scavenged machine parts and beer tubes, these men and women invented the field of open heart surgery. Odds are, someone you know is alive because of them. So why has history left them behind? Presented by Chris Pine, CARDIAC COWBOYS tells the gripping true story behind the birth of heart surgery, and the young, Greatest Generation doctors who made it happen. For years, they competed and feuded, racing to be the first, the best, and the most prolific. Some appeared on the cover of Time Magazine, operated on kings and advised presidents. Others ended up disgraced, penniless, and convicted of felonies. Together, they ignited a revolution in medicine, and changed the world.
